Output b3ef81bc8dd1523981583330efbae7106a29775f6293fb9c805a9233e2e0edcb:2

value
2552500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f2de09f4dff75bc80139772692ba9baea1701a OP_EQUAL
address
3CG6aKgFU53NQi92oDZFGEACuPNvETfN6X
transaction
b3ef81bc8dd1523981583330efbae7106a29775f6293fb9c805a9233e2e0edcb
confirmations
319420
spent
true